The Anatomy of an Earnings Call
A typical earnings call follows a structured format that AI is particularly good at analyzing. The call begins with the CEO's prepared remarks — usually 10-15 minutes covering business highlights, strategic initiatives, and high-level performance. Next, the CFO presents the financial review — 10-15 minutes of detailed financial metrics, segment performance, and guidance. Finally, the Q&A session with sell-side analysts — often the most revealing 15-30 minutes of the call.
Ecomerate's AI processes each segment differently. For the prepared remarks, it extracts strategic themes and management priorities. For the financial review, it pulls structured data points — revenue, EPS, margins, segment breakdowns — and compares them against analyst consensus. For the Q&A, it performs the most sophisticated analysis: detecting evasive language, measuring management confidence, identifying which questions triggered defensive responses, and flagging topics where management seems less forthcoming.
Management Tone: The Hidden Signal
Academic research has shown that management tone during earnings calls — particularly in the Q&A session — contains predictive information about future stock returns. Ecomerate's AI analyzes tone along multiple dimensions: certainty vs. hedging — frequency of words like 'confident,' 'committed' vs 'may,' 'might,' 'could'; emotional valence — positive vs negative language; Q&A defensiveness — how directly management answers analyst questions; and temporal shift — how tone changes between prepared remarks (rehearsed) and Q&A (spontaneous).

What can AI detect in management tone during earnings calls?
AI sentiment analysis can detect: confidence levels based on certainty words, hedging language ('we may' vs 'we will'), emotional tone shifts during Q&A compared to prepared remarks, evasive answers to analyst questions, and changes in language patterns compared to prior calls. Research shows management tone detected by AI can predict stock price movements up to 30 days after the call.
